Wine Tasting Trip Memories

"Napa Riverfront"
Watercolor

It is our anniversary month around here, so what would make a good subject to paint? How about a scene from the vacation that we took to celebrate our 20th year of marriage?! It was such a fun trip! For once, my husband made ALL of the plans; each time he consulted with me, I would say, "Don't ask my opinion, surprise me." We stayed in a charming bed and breakfast, ate at one of Iron Chef Morimoto's restaurants and spent a day in a Packard limo visiting three vineyards (Frank Family, Bremer & Keever) and having a picnic lunch on Deer Creek. I'll never forget it!

I took the photo that I used to paint this photo from one of the bridges crossing the river on our walk to the Oxbow Market. What a great suggestion that was! It was definitely worth a visit. We had lunch at the Hog Island Oyster Company. (I don't remember what I had; I don't eat raw oysters.) Dwight fell in love with their "hog wash."

This is my second painting from that trip. My first, I titled Old Bike in Bloom and it was based on a photo I took on the top of a hill at Keever.
